Mothers Union

The Mothers’ Union is a Christian organisation which promotes the well-being of families worldwide.

In the Ellesmere Branch of the Mothers Union we have a lively, friendly fellowship. As well as having an interesting programme of speakers, trips and social events, we are involved in a number of local projects, for example providing toiletries for women in a local Women’s Refuge, making story sacks for a local playgroup, and knitting for premature babies.

We meet on the second Monday of each month in St John’s Room at 2.00 pm.

You do not have to be a mother to be a member of Mothers Union, as membership is open to anyone (male or female) who has been baptised in the name of the Holy Trinity.
